Causes of sore throat tickling cough for many reasons, including colds, acute pharyngitis, acute trachea – bronchitis, etc., fast cough method generally take symptomatic treatment, but only the cause of the treatment can completely stop cough.
1. Symptomatic treatment: If the cough is severe, you can take dextromethorphan, Pentoxyverine, etc., and if you have a sore or itchy throat, you can take ibuprofen and other symptomatic treatments.
2. Treatment of causes:
(1) Colds: at the initial stage, there is a dry, itchy or burning sensation in the throat, and some patients may have symptoms such as cough. For patients with mild symptoms of common cold, no special treatment is needed, and they should drink more water and rest. Those with severe symptoms can take Yinqiao antidote tablets, cold and flu punch and so on.
(2) Acute pharyngolaryngitis: the main symptoms are dry pharynx, itchy pharynx, sore throat, cough, fever, hoarseness, etc. The main symptoms of acute pharyngolaryngitis are dry pharynx, itchy pharynx, sore throat, cough, fever and hoarseness. If bacterial infection caused by acute pharyngolaryngitis, available drugs include penicillin, cephalosporin, etc.; viral infection can be applied to ribavirin, amantadine, etc..
(3) Acute trachea-bronchitis: Cough is a typical symptom of acute bronchitis, and coughing for a long time will be accompanied by sore throat and sputum. Commonly used drugs include aminoglutethimide hydrochloride, bromhexine hydrochloride and other cough and phlegm treatment; erythromycin, clarithromycin, azithromycin and other anti-infective treatment.
Besides the above diseases, allergic pharyngitis can also cause the above diseases. If the above symptoms are not relieved, you should go to the hospital in time to find out the cause and give targeted treatment. The above medications should be used under the guidance of a pharmacist or doctor, avoid self-medication.
